Sentiment amounts to the analysis of text in order to ascertain its positivity, negativity, or neutrality. This is what businesses are doing with customer data from various sources like chats, emails, social media, and reviews to know how their customers are feeling.
The business can improve customer experience and enhance brand reputation through understanding customers’ sentiments, leading to actionable insights.
Other than checking out what people say about your brand online, sentiment analysis tools are also widely used in inbound call center. They enable us to determine whether customers were happy whenever they talked on the phone, sent a message or an email, or conversed through chats.
Consequently, it is possible to forward such messages to an agent who specializes in facing angry customers.
Furthermore, the sentiment can get calculated for each agent, which helps find out the best practices and ways of improving them.
In conjunction with the other customer experience metrics, including Net Promoter Scores, sentiment analysis models bring in the bigger picture of how consumers perceive their experiences.
The most basic sentiment analysis techniques are the ”wordlist” techniques, which employ lists of positive and negative words (e.g. bad=negative, happy=positive) and merely score content by counting how many times each appears. Word listing methods offer a baseline score, but they tend to be weak in themselves.
For example, the sentence “I’m really not satisfied with your new sale prices or happy” has more words that are positive than those that are negative on technicality.
Advances in techniques will result in parsing of sentences by making use of NLP techniques for analyzing the structure and machine-learning models that deal with slang or sarcasm.
The systems that have invented it are able to detect tone of voice, consider the order of words, and separate different parts which drive sentiment in a sentence.
The most precise sentiment scoring for business phone systems comes from building tailored models using your own customer calls and vocabulary with a manually created training dataset, though this process is often time-consuming and costly.
There are a number of major steps to take when analyzing sentiments at call centers
.webp)
Data Collection
People collect conversational data relating to channels like phone calls, emails, or live chats.
Text Processing
Analysis necessitates cleaning, tokenizing, and transforming the data into a suitable format.
Sentiment Classification
Text classification is done by machine learning models, which can rate it as positive, negative, or neutral.
Feature Extraction
In order to comprehend the sentiment, linguistic and contextual aspects are drawn out
Sentiment Scoring
A sentiment score is assigned to each interaction.
Aggregation and Analysis
Trends and patterns can be identified through aggregation of sentiment scores.
